Eet? what are these three letters i see floating around pinterest and speech blogs? what is the hype? well, the eet is the expanding expression tool. it is a tool created by sara l. smith that is used to improve expressive language. this tool can be used to show students all the different pieces of information they can use when describing.

To read (. 803. words) the expanding expression tool (eet) is an amazing resource created by sara l smith. you can find the kit here, but i just wanted to relay how it is being used in my speech room. our kiddos with expressive language disorders have a very difficult time expressing common vocabulary, retelling events, and much more. This simple, yet brilliant multisensory program will dramatically boost the following language skills: the expanding expression tool is a color coded system of symbols. students learn the code and from this code are able to provide detailed descriptions based on the following elements: as a mnemonic device, it provides visual and tactile.
